After long speculation, rumors and an eventual confirmation, Assassin’s Creed III has a been given a release date of Oct. 30 (the announcement comes to no surprise to most gamers worldwide).
The rumors have been flying on the release date of Diablo III, with it all aiming towards April. The date has still yet to be announced but the April release window is looking almost dead on since Blizzard is putting PvP on hold.

Guild Wars 2 is something off in the near future, but their closed beta is getting amped up and readied to be downloaded soon. The closed beta signups were open for a mere 48 hours, but within the span of the 48 hours, masses of Guild War lovers about 4,000 per minute signed up. I have a hunch that NC Soft has another sleeping giant on their hands.
